About Strathpine Safe Space

The Strathpine Safe Space is an extension of Neami services and is part of a network of Safe Spaces across the Brisbane North Region that aim to support those individuals experiencing significant mental distress. The Safe Space will provide an inclusive and trauma informed environment, supported by Peer Workers and Clinicians. Neami staff will work within a Collaborative Relation Practise framework, using evidence based and best practice approaches to support guests that visit the service. The Safe Space will operate every day, outside usual office hours and provide a welcoming and compassionate space for those that need immediate emotional support.
